Three Phases: What the Blood Data Actually Showed
I can see in hindsight that my fourteen months of results fell into three distinct phases. I didn’t spot the pattern at the time. It only became visible when I laid the tests side by side. (WMTWL-MOM-250)
Month one: relief.
February 2024. One month after stopping all medication, with my GP’s knowledge and monthly tests scheduled: total cholesterol 7.0. Down from 8.0 while I was on statins. I checked the printout twice. LDL improving. Kidney function excellent. (WMTWL-MOM-246)
The number that surprised me most was ALT, my liver enzyme. It dropped from 69 to 28 in thirty days. The normal range is under 40. I’d been above that range while on statins, and one month of 18:6 fasting, giving my liver a rest from processing medication every day, dropped it by 59%. (WMTWL-MOM-241)
Month eleven: reversal.
January 2025. HbA1c: 40 mmol/mol. Normal range. In December 2023 it had been 46, solidly pre-diabetic. I’d spent years watching that number creep upward despite being on medication, despite doing what I was told. Eleven months off all medication, eleven months of consistent 18:6 fasting and non-UPF eating, and it had reversed. Not managed. Reversed. (WMTWL-MOM-259)
Month fourteen: optimisation.
April 2025. HbA1c 37 mmol/mol. The lowest reading in my data going back to 2012set. LDL: 3.8, down from 5.6 off-medication baseline. Cholesterol/HDL ratio: 4.7, within target for the first time in years.
And then the CRP number. January 2025, CRP was 6.2, technically in the normal range but sitting in the upper half. April 2025: 1.0. An 84% reduction in three months. (WMTWL-MOM-262)
Six medications. All of them for conditions with inflammation somewhere in their story. And the marker that measures systemic inflammation had dropped to near-zero without a single drug.
The Honest Parts: What Didn’t Go Smoothly
I want to be straight about the things that didn’t follow the script.
Around month eleven, my ferritin was dropping. Iron levels declining. I assumed it was the fasting, the reduced food volume. Partly true, it turned out. But the actual cause, once my GP investigated properly, was bleeding piles. Chronic blood loss over months. Nothing to do with the eating window at all. Got treated, problem addressed, levels recovering. That’s what proper monitoring looks like. Not assuming. Investigating. (WMTWL-MOM-316)
The other honest thing: my triglycerides at month fourteen were 4.3, elevated. They’d been 2.3 at month one. I don’t have a clean explanation for that yet. Possibly the timing relative to recent extended fasting. Possibly dietary composition. Possibly lab variation. I’m tracking it. One abnormal marker doesn’t erase the trajectory, but it also doesn’t get ignored. That’s the deal you make when you choose data over assumption.
